"Insightful, intimate, self-reflective bordering on the macabre, sensual. An intimate look into the private life of an artist and his models, reflecting the author's own experience." Vincent Proudfoot is a young Onondaga native from Upper New York State. He is an emerging artist who struggles with a persistent conflict between his native identity and the glamour of an outside art world. He is modestly successful but not fulfilled. A visit to ArtExpo 80 in New York changes him forever. Determined he leaves for Seattle to begin a new life as an artist. He discovers a passion for drawing nude models. To succeed, however, he plots a bizarre event that will shake the art world. With a cast of colourful characters, a body floating in Puget Sound, passionate relationships, many models, and set in the gallery-row district of Seattle's Pioneer Square, Death of a Model spans some 10 years and unfolds as a personal journey of awakening - at any cost.
